Well, the Hawks did indeed SHOCK THE WORLD against the Los Angeles Lakers on Wednesday! With a 96-92 victory and a severely sprained Kobe Bryant ankle, the resilient Atlanta Hawks topped with Lakers without the services of Jeff Teague, Josh Smith, Lou Williams, Deshawn Stevenson, and Zaza Pachulia. What has been lost in a sea of media coverage about the Kobe Bryant ankle injury, the play that created this situation, and whether or not it was intentional is the fact that a starting line-up of Devin Harris, Dahntay Jones, Anthony Tolliver, Al Horford, and Johan Petro totally OUTEXECUTED the Lakers league of Steve Nash, Kobe Bryant, Metta World Peace, Earl Clark, and Dwight Howard. AND the Hawks bench outscored the Lakers 39-16 thanks to the likes of Kyle Korver (15), Ivan "The Terrible" Johnson (12), rookie John Jenkins(12), and 10-day contract Shelvin Mack(7).

Its hard to even pick a PLAYER OF THE GAME for the Hawks because it was such a balanced team effort, something the Lakers are still learning, but if we had to pick one it would have to be Al Horford, playing a team-high 41 minutes for 14 pts (7/12 FGs) 14 rbs 4 asts. He should have gotten AT LEAST 20 FGA but the Hawks played to their strengths and got the win (FAIR AND SQUARE, KOBE BRYANT!)
Don't be mad at me, just ask Steve Nash how they lost this game:
"We just didn't make any shots, I feel like I killed us tonight. I had good looks at the basket. I didn't convert."
 Steve Nash was 4/14 from the field, one of the things that led to a 55-43 Hawks lead at halftime. Kobe Bryant was having a tough game by halftime, 3 points on 1/8 shooting, and EVERYBODY expected Kobe to erupt in the 3rd, which he did, kind of... 20 points in the 3rd and the Lakers won the 3rd quarter 31-21 but the healthly lead build by the Hawks in the 1st half proved to be a solid foundation, the Hawks won the 4th quarter 20-18 on several great plays by Devin Harris, Kyle Korver, even Johan Petro and Ivan Johnson(!!). Ivan made a HUGE play down the stretch, with the Hawks leading 90-87 Al Horford drove along the baseline and missed the shot. But he hustled for the rebound and knocked it right to Johnson under the basket. He flipped in a reverse layup with 33.3 seconds remaining, pushing the Hawks ahead 92-87.

Al Horford scores career-high as Josh Smith anchors a balanced offense and defense in a 102-91 win over Utah for 4th place in East

A brilliant performance.

The Utah Jazz were determined to get a win after a gut-wrenching overtime defeat against the Boston Celtics where Paul Pierce scored 26 points, 7 in OT to give the Jazz their 26th loss. Knowing the Los Angeles Lakers were gunning for their playoffs-necks, they were determined to beat the visiting 14-13 road record Atlanta Hawks.

But the Hawks were TOO GOOD!

Josh Smith led the Hawks in a brilliant performance as the Hawks went into the 4th quarter with a 82-56 lead and survived a futile rally for a 102-91 victory. Josh had one of his classic, awesome "i-cant-believe-this-guy-is-not-an-all-star-WTF-is-wrong-with-you-NBA-coaches" games, scoring 24 pts (9/19 FGs 1/4 3ptFGs 5/7 FTs) 14 rbs (3 off) 7 asts and 1 stl. He virtually controlled the pace of the game in all 42 minutes of his playing time, imposing his will on the game definitely helped Al Horford have an AMAZING GAME scoring a career-high 34 pts (14/22 FGs 6/6 FTs) 15 rbs (4 off) 5 BLOCKS! and 3 asts in 43 minutes of playing time. It was Josh Smith's 8th game this season with 7 assists or more and his 8th game with 24 pts or better.

Al Horford described the the grit and determination he and Josh play with now as the primary scorers on the team, "We just kept fighting and I kept fighting. we worked too hard to give it up," Horford said. "It was one of those things where you don't want to lose, so you kind of do whatever you have to do."

Al Horford seems to be the biggest beneficiary of the Joe Johnson trade for the Hawks, he has always led the team (AND led the LEAGUE at his position!) in Field Goal %, with more touches in a more balanced offense he has averaged a career-high scoring average, which has his season stats at 17.1 ppg 10.1 rpg 3.2 apg on 55.6% FGs, tell me that's not an ALL-STAR! but a career-low free throw shooting at 61.5% 



Jeff Teague had a great game orchestrating the offense and being at the right spots on time, he scored 19 pts and 7 asts, and Devin Harris has been a good duel-point guard starter with Jeff as he scores 12 pts.

The Hawks are now 33-23, on pace for a 48-24 record, an IMPROVED winning percentage from last season, they continue their road trip by going against the Phoenix Suns on Friday and the Los Angeles Lakers on Sunday.
